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7334363612 31079616 30 39122833351 770796
36129879 99965 8632835653
36129879 99965 8632835653
4530000455 464584 1924
All about undefined
Interested in learning more?
36129879 99965 8632835653
4530000455 464584 1924
See more
10 2504378899
4022691 438 30323005 8553503 8256
See more
443911 9846286770 50
868208576 311 670468062
See more